We are grateful for MAGIs support of the Scandinavian Gem Symposium 2016, propably the most important gemmological event ever in Scandinavia!
The list of speakers include John Koivula, Thomas Hainschwang, Peter Lyckberg, Peters Brangulis, Conny Forsberg and myself. John Koivulas presentation is titeled "Crystalline Showcases", Hainschwang is one of the worlds greatest experts in synthetic and treated diamonds, Peters Brangulis will give a talk on how the Assay office in Latvia practically works as there are regulations concerning the testing of gemstones over a certain value. Peter Lyckberg is one of our greatest experts on gem bearing pegmatites. Conny Forsberg will give a talk on the cutting of gemstones, why so many stones gets apparently bad cuts and how and when to decide on recuts. Jan Asplund will explain why and how we ever learned how to synthesis diamonds and will also try to straighten out and correct some of the misunderstandings and errors that has been published on the subject from the 1950s until today.

Here is the program:

Scandinavian Gem Symposium 18 Juni 2016.
Location: ”Kulturkuben”, Östgötagatan 8 in Kisa, Sweden.

8.00 Open for registration.
9.00 Welcoming and Introduction. Conny Forsberg och Jan Asplund.
9.10 Sweden from Precambrian to modern gemology. Geology, mineralogy, chemistry, history and its importance for development of sciences. - Peter Lyckberg.
9.30 Building trust to gem market: Latvian experience. - Peters Brangulis.
10.00 Advanced Gemmological instruments by MAGI - Alberto Scarani och Mikko Åström.

10.15 Break, coffe, snacks and networking.

10.45 Crystalline Showcases. - John Koivula.
11.45 Commercial vs Precision Cut. - Conny Forsberg.

12.15 Lunch.

13.30 "To be Announced" - Geoffrey Dominy.
13.50 On the History of the Science of Diamonds. - Jan Asplund.
14.20 The (R)Evolution of Synthetic and Treated Diamonds in the Gem Market: From Single Stones to Melee. - Thomas Hainschwang.

15.20 Break, coffe, snacks and networking.

16.00 Gem Pegmatites, formation, geology-mineralogy-gemology. Some observations from In situ studies on 5 continents. - Peter Lyckberg.
16.45 Round table talks on ethics and fair trade.
17.30 Finish - Conny Forsberg och Jan Asplund.

(Times mentioned are estimations and slight changes to the program may occur)
